The federal government plans to auction a combined 75 billion naira ($454.5 million) and 105 billion naira ($636.4 million) of three-year and 10-year bonds during the second quarter, the country’s debt management office said on Monday.

It will raise 25 billion naira in three-year bills and 35 billion naira in 10-year notes respectively in each of April, May and June.

All are re-openings of previously issued debt.
